[livejournal.com profile] sgwordy  's recent post about a song reminded me of a couple of songs that make me think of the Attolia books every time I hear them.

The first, Secret Heart by Ron Sexsmith, was not my idea--it was someone else's--but I really like it and even though the lyrics are about a man they seem more like Attolia while she was hiding how she felt about Eugenides in QoA.  You can read the lyrics here and listen to it on youtube here.  Pay no attention to the creepy doll, monkey and clown images.  They scare me, but maybe you are braver.  I like to focus, instead, on his lovely white shirt with its crisp collar points, for some unknown reason.

The other song is an older one by Van Morrison called I'll Be Your Lover, Too.  It's been in two movies--Proof of Life (2000) and Moonlight Mile (2002).  I had a really hard time finding it online but the lyrics and song are in this random girl's blog.  C'mon now, admit it--every word of the lyrics makes you think of Gen and Irene.   Yes, they do.

Before you go listen, promise me one little thing.  Swear that you will not...NOT...listen to Robert Pattinson do his rendition on youtube.  You'll be scrubbing your brain with acid, trust me.  It's Van you want.
